More information about Hanscraft & Co. Bavarian Nice Kazbek Melon
The new beer from Hanscraft & Co. is a pale ale. The pale ale has a slim 5.0% alcohol content and is cold-hopped with two different hop varieties. Huell Melon and Kazbek give the pale ale its fruity-fresh character, while the wheat malt provides the velvety-soft mouthfeel.
Bayerisch Nizza Kazbek Melon flows into the glass in naturally cloudy amber gold and is adorned with a small crown of fine-pored, creamy foam. The aroma of the pale ale is decidedly fruity: tangy notes of citrus fruits combine with the aroma of freshly picked berries to create a summery symphony. The first sip caresses the palate with a mild texture and juicy fruit notes. The aromas of sun-ripened orange and sweet strawberry are particularly striking. The latest addition to Hanscraft & Co.'s wide range is a refreshing pale ale with soft fruity notes and a summery character.
Thanks to its mild aroma and tangy fruit notes, the Kazbek melon version of Bayerisch Nizza goes wonderfully with a variety of dishes. We particularly like to drink the pale pale ale with spicy dishes or dishes containing fruit. We therefore recommend a green Thai curry with sugar snaps and chicken with fragrant jasmine rice and a mango parfait with honey and caramelized nuts for dessert. The beer elegantly balances out the spiciness of the curry and emphasizes the fresh fruitiness of the mango.

Hanscraft & Co.
What do teeth and beer have in common? Christian! Christian Hans Müller, the head and heart behind Hanscraft & Co. is not actually a brewer, but a dentist. At least he used to be, because now he is a full-blooded brewer. Concept beer Beer in the club is nothing new, but beer in a fine restaurant is. In addition to the club world, Christian also wants to conquer the upscale temples of pleasure with Hanscraft & Co. As a passionate beer drinker and connoisseur, Christian wants to make beers that can be enjoyed not only with steak from the grill but also with filet in a starred restaurant. Refined, multi-layered beers with ambition and of quality, that is the goal. That, and beers you can drink at the disco.
